How to use

A few drops, a steady rhythm

Use intentionally, in small amounts, as part of a mindful practice.

The herbs can be enjoyed in a pipe, rolled in natural papers, or simply burned as an aromatic in a fireproof bowl during meditation or ritual.

This is a ritual blend — not a daily consumable. Any combustion of plant material carries lung-irritation risk; those with respiratory conditions should use the aromatic method only.

For adults only.

What's inside

Every herb, named

  • Holy Basil (Tulsi)
    Ocimum sanctum

    Uplifts — traditionally used to support a clear, centered emotional state. Ayurveda's 'queen of herbs.'*

    Grown in Gaia's Umpire medicine garden.

  • Motherwort
    Leonurus cardiaca

    Grounds — traditional heart-and-nerve tonic that settles anxious edges.*

    Grown in Gaia's Umpire medicine garden.

  • Spearmint
    Mentha spicata

    Refreshes — the softer, gentler cousin-to-peppermint. Brightens the blend.*

    Grown in Gaia's Umpire medicine garden.

  • Mullein
    Verbascum thapsus

    Soothes — classic respiratory ally traditionally used in smoking blends for its softness on the airways.*

    Grown in Gaia's Umpire medicine garden.

  • Passionflower
    Passiflora incarnata

    Relaxes — traditional nervine specifically suited to busy, over-thinking minds.*

    Grown in Gaia's Umpire medicine garden.
